Now being discussed on the Volunteers and Technology forum at TechSoup: Who owns what you create as a volunteer? When you have volunteered, has the organization had you sign anything that says what you create becomes its property? Or, has the organization even discussed ownership issues with you? Or, have you ever faced a misunderstanding/disagreement about such? Visit the TechSoup forum and talk about your experience as a volunteer -- or a manager of such.

Just updated: tips for Choosing Specialized Software, or Or Using What You Already Have. This is advice regarding what to look for in software for mission-based organizations: label-making software, volunteer management software, project management software, presentation software, art work software, client-management software, fund raising software, etc. Also reviews the "Buy v. Build" database debate, and what to look for in a particular software package, etc.
